Background
In the continuous casting production line of iron and steel enterprises, the sector is the key equipment of conticaster, the continuous casting roller wherein is the important part of sector, the drive roller and the 200 free rollers of continuous casting roller are the most difficult part of assembly and processing again, the drive roller has three kinds of specifications 200, 230, 250, the 200 free rollers comprises long section and nipple joint, the structure is all that a dabber and four sections roller shell suit are in the same place, dabber and roller shell are transition fit, every sector has 2 drive rollers altogether, 28 sections of 200 free rollers, in order to reduce manufacturing cost, the off-line restoration of continuous casting roller is the key ring of cost reduction increase.
However, the existing roller dismounting device cannot change the fixed range according to the specifications of different rollers, and is not beneficial to normal dismounting of the rollers, so that the applicability of the roller dismounting device is reduced, and the popularization of the device is affected.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
A device for detaching the segment roll of a continuous casting machine as shown in fig. 1-4, comprises a worktable 1, a first through groove 2 and a second through groove 3 are arranged at one end of the top of the workbench 1 in a penetrating way, a first supporting plate 4 is arranged in the inner cavity of the first through groove 2 in a penetrating way, a second supporting plate 5 is arranged in the inner cavity of the second through groove 3 in a penetrating way, a first fixing claw 6 is fixedly arranged at the top of one side of the first supporting plate 4, a second fixed claw 8 is fixedly arranged at the top end of one side of the second supporting plate 5, a side plate 9 is fixedly arranged at one end of the top of the workbench 1, a hydraulic cylinder 10 is fixedly arranged on one side of the side plate 9, a placing plate 11 is arranged on one side of the side plate 9, a placing groove 12 is arranged on the top of the placing plate 11, a positive and negative motor 13 is fixedly arranged at one end of the inner cavity of the workbench 1, an output shaft of the forward and reverse motor 13 is fixedly provided with a screw rod 14, and one end of the screw rod 14 sequentially penetrates through one side of the first supporting plate 4 and one side of the second supporting plate 5;
the first supporting plate 4 and the second supporting plate 5 are both fixedly connected with the screw rod through threads, and the threads inside the first supporting plate 4 and the second supporting plate 5 are arranged to be mutually reverse threads;
two ends of the inner side of the first fixed claw 6 are respectively provided with a claw groove 7 in a penetrating way, and the second fixed claw 8 is matched with the claw grooves 7;
the straight line where the central axis of the hydraulic cylinder 10 is located and the straight line where the central axis of the placing groove 12 is located are horizontally arranged in a collinear manner;
a limiting plate 15 is fixedly arranged at one end inside the workbench 1, a bearing 16 is embedded inside the limiting plate 15, and one end of the lead screw 14 is embedded into an inner ring of the bearing 16;
a sliding groove 17 is formed in one end of the inner portion of the workbench 1, sliding blocks 18 are fixedly arranged at the bottoms of the first supporting plate 4 and the second supporting plate 5, and the sliding blocks 18 are matched with the sliding grooves 17;
the inner sides of the first fixed claw 6 and the second fixed claw 8 are both fixedly provided with a protective pad 19, and the protective pad 19 is made of rubber materials.
The specific implementation mode is as follows: when processing, the roller that will wait to dismantle is placed in standing groove 12, and make the one end of roller laminate mutually with pneumatic cylinder 10 one end, then, start positive and negative motor 13, make positive and negative motor 13 drive lead screw 14 and rotate, lead screw 14 drives first backup pad 4 and second backup pad 5 simultaneously and is close to each other, first backup pad 4 and second backup pad 5 drive first stationary dog 6 and second stationary dog 8 respectively simultaneously and move like the roller shell, and fix the roller shell, then, start pneumatic cylinder 10, make pneumatic cylinder 10 extrude roller one end, make the roller core break away from the roller shell, thereby accomplish the dismantlement work to the roller.
